Revision: 6477
http://sourceforge.net/p/jump-pilot/code/6477
Author: ma15569
Date: 2020-09-14 11:49:35 +0000 (Mon, 14 Sep 2020)
Log Message:
-----------
Logger to control loading of RasterImageLayers
Modified Paths:
--------------
core/trunk/src/org/openjump/core/rasterimage/RasterImageLayer.java
Modified: core/trunk/src/org/openjump/core/rasterimage/RasterImageLayer.java
===================================================================
--- core/trunk/src/org/openjump/core/rasterimage/RasterImageLayer.java
2020-09-14 11:37:22 UTC (rev 6476)
+++ core/trunk/src/org/openjump/core/rasterimage/RasterImageLayer.java
2020-09-14 11:49:35 UTC (rev 6477)
@@ -38,6 +38,7 @@
import com.vividsolutions.jts.geom.Polygon;
import com.vividsolutions.jump.I18N;
import com.vividsolutions.jump.util.Blackboard;
+import com.vividsolutions.jump.util.Timer;
import com.vividsolutions.jump.workbench.Logger;
import com.vividsolutions.jump.workbench.WorkbenchContext;
import com.vividsolutions.jump.workbench.model.AbstractLayerable;
@@ -544,8 +545,9 @@
// Rectangle visibleRect = viewport.getPanel().getVisibleRect();
Resolution requestedRes =
RasterImageIO.calcRequestedResolution(viewport);
-
+ long start = Timer.milliSecondsSince(0);
ImageAndMetadata imageAndMetadata =
rasterImageIO.loadImage(getWorkbenchContext(), imageFileName, stats,
viewport.getEnvelopeInModelCoordinates(), requestedRes);
+ Logger.info("Reading '"+getName()+"' took
"+Timer.secondsSinceString(start)+"s.");
metadata = imageAndMetadata.getMetadata();
image = imageAndMetadata.getImage();
numBands = metadata.getStats().getBandCount();
_______________________________________________
Jump-pilot-devel mailing list
[email protected]
https://lists.sourceforge.net/lists/listinfo/jump-pilot-devel